pol2Kakinada: District Collector Neetu Kumari Prasad said that sports are a relief from the day-to-day pressures and tensions. On Sunday a cricket match was held at the District Sports Authority stadium between the teams of Revenue and Police departments (Collector Vs SP). While Ms Neetu Kumari was the captain of the Revenue team SP Sivashankar Reddy captained the Police team. Inaugurating the match, the Collector said that government employees undergo a lot of stress in their work. To overcome this, some sort of exercise like walking or playing the sport of their choice is necessary. Sports not only relieve stress but also create physical well being and mental peace but also refreshes the mind to work more efficiently, she said. She suggested that all employees should practice some exercise to gain mental and physical well being. As Revenue and Police departments work under great pressure, such kind of sporting activity is necessary for them, she said. On this occasion, the SP said that daily exercise is a must for the Police personnel as the police can be alert and work much more efficiently by participating in sports activities. He urged the employees to participate in any sporting activity or at least take to walking. The Collector and the SP introduced the teams to each other at the start of the game. The Revenue team won the toss to field. The Police team that batted first made 229 runs for a loss of five wickets. Later, the Revenue team was all out for 53 runs. The Police team was declared as the winner. District Cricket Association members Ravi and Rangaraya Medical College PD Swaranjan Raju were the umpires. District Additional SP Satyanarayana, Kakinada APSP third battalion Commandant Rajesh Kumar, DSDO SV Ramana, SP CEO K Jayaraj, Kakinada RDO Jawaharlal Nehru, Kakinada Urban Tahsildar Ramamurthy and others participated.
